How Common Is The Last Name Filipin? popularity and diffusion

The last name is the 365,146th most numerous family name on a global scale It is held by approximately 1 in 7,376,059 people. This last name occurs mostly in The Americas, where 73 percent of Filipin reside; 72 percent reside in South America and 71 percent reside in Luso-South America. It is also the 1,688,769th most frequently occurring first name at a global level It is held by 37 people.

The last name is most frequently held in Brazil, where it is carried by 699 people, or 1 in 306,258. In Brazil Filipin is primarily concentrated in: Rio Grande do Sul, where 31 percent reside, São Paulo, where 27 percent reside and Paraná, where 18 percent reside. Other than Brazil Filipin exists in 23 countries. It also occurs in Croatia, where 12 percent reside and Serbia, where 6 percent reside.
